Patty Mills ranks #1811 all time. Across his three best seasons, his average league finish was #61.3. His full-career value ranks #674, so longevity is a major reason he lands this high. Explore Patty Mills's advanced stats by season, era-adjusted impact, workload, and historical comparisons.

How to read this page

Impact Rate shows how strong a player was compared with everyone else that season. Season Value adds how much he played. The career ranking rewards a high peak, a long prime, and repeated seasons near the top. Older seasons use clearly labeled estimates where the NBA did not record today's full set of statistics.
